Are there any practical placements required for the Level 2 + Level 3 + Level 4 Diploma in Health and Social Care part time?

Practical Placements for Health and Social Care Diplomas

For the Level 2, Level 3, and Level 4 Diploma in Health and Social Care part-time courses, practical placements are indeed required. These placements are an essential component of the curriculum, as they provide students with valuable hands-on experience in real-world healthcare settings.

During these placements, students have the opportunity to apply the knowledge and skills they have learned in the classroom to actual patient care scenarios. This practical experience is crucial for developing the necessary competencies and confidence needed to succeed in the field of health and social care.

Placements are typically arranged by the educational institution in collaboration with healthcare facilities and organizations. Students are supervised and supported by qualified professionals throughout their placement to ensure a safe and enriching learning experience.

Overall, practical placements play a vital role in the education and training of health and social care professionals. They offer students the chance to gain practical skills, build professional networks, and enhance their employability upon graduation.
